Wizard's Eighth Rule
The Wizard's Eighth Rule, revealed in Naked Empire, is:
Deserve victory. (Translated from "Talga Vassternich" in High D'Haran, a literary fictional language) —Chapter 61, p.626, U.S. hardcover editionIt is explained in the novel as follows: "Be justified in your convictions. Be completely committed. Earn what you want and need rather than waiting for others to give you what you desire."
